About our Opportunity
We’re looking for a Mechanical Fitter to join our Ball Clays Engineering team at Heathfield.
This is a hands‑on, site‑based role providing mechanical support to fixed plant and processing equipment across the Devon Ball Clays operations. You’ll play a key part in maintaining plant availability through planned preventive maintenance, breakdown response and continuous improvement work.
You’ll work closely with Plant Supervisors and the wider maintenance team to plan shutdown activities, ensure parts are ordered and available, and support equipment installations and improvement projects — all while maintaining a strong focus on safety and environmental standards.
What you will be doing
Mechanical maintenance & breakdown response
* Carrying out planned and reactive mechanical maintenance on fixed plant, including mills, conveyors, fans, filters and packaging systems
* Fault finding and resolving mechanical issues to minimise downtime
* Supporting installation, commissioning and modification of equipment
Planning & site coordination
* Working with Plant Supervisors to plan access, shutdowns and maintenance activities
* Ordering and managing spares to support planned work
* Recording work completed and contributing to root cause analysis
Safety, quality & compliance
* Working in line with Imerys Safe Working Rules and site procedures
* Maintaining clean, safe and organised work areas
* Supporting compliance with EHSQ requirements at all times
